The US House of Representatives approved a bill last year that would ban TikTok, owned by Chinese company ByteDance, in the US unless its assets were sold to another company.
“This bill protects Americans, and especially American children, from the harmful effects of Chinese propaganda on the TikTok app. This app is a spy baloon on Americans’ phones,” House Foreign Affairs Committee Chairman Michael McCaul said after the vote.
